Full Notice Text
TO: OCCUPANT; NICHOLAS J. SIMICH; THE MIRAGE HOMEOWNERS ASSOCIATION; Village of Plainfield; WILL COUNTY CLERK; ANA GALVEZ; PATHWAY PROPERTY MANAGEMENT, INC.; AND ALL UNKNOWN OWNERS AND PARTIES INTERESTED. TAX DEED NO.: 2026TX000044 FILED: 02/13/2026 TAKE NOTICE County of Will Date Premises Sold 12/04/2023 Certificate No. 22-00424 Sold for General Taxes of (year) 2022 Sold for Special Assessment of (Municipality)Not Applicable and special assessment number Not Applicable Warrant No. Not Applicable Inst. No. Not Applicable THIS PROPERTY HAS BEEN SOLD FOR DELINQUENT TAXES Property located at 6916 TWIN FALLS DR PLAINFIELD IL Legal Description or Property Index No. 06-03-30-104-073-0000 This notice is to advise you that the above property has been sold for delinquent taxes and that the period of redemption from the sale will expire on 08/07/2026. The amount to redeem is subject to increase at 6 month intervals from the date of sale and may be further increased if the purchaser at the tax sale or his or her assignee pays any subsequently accruing taxes or special assessments to redeem the property from subsequent forfeitures or tax sales. Check with the county clerk as to the exact amount you owe before redeeming. This notice is also to advise you that a petition has been filed for a tax deed which will transfer title and the right to possession of this property if redemption is not made on or before 08/07/2026. This matter is set for hearing in the Circuit Court of this county, in 100 W Jefferson St, Courtroom 904 Joliet, Illinois on 08/25/2026 at 9:15 a.m. You may be present at this hearing but your right to redeem will already have expired at that time. YOU ARE URGED TO REDEEM IMMEDIATELY TO PREVENT LOSS OF PROPERTY Redemption can be made at any time on or before 08/07/2026 by applying to the County Clerk of Will County, Illinois, at the Office of the County Clerk in Joliet, Illinois. FOR FURTHER INFORMATION CONTACT THE COUNTY CLERK ADDRESS: 302 North Chicago St., Joliet, IL 60432 TELEPHONE: (815) 724-1880 American Tax Lien, LLC, Purchaser or Assignee.
